#312055 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#312055 is composed of 19.2% red, 12.5%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.4% cyan, 62.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 259.2 degrees, a saturation of 45.3% and a lightness of 22.9%. #312055 color hex could be obtained by blending #6240aa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#312055 color description : Very dark violet.
#312055 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#312055 has RGB values of R:49, G:32,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 3219541.

Shades and Tints of #312055
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08050e is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#312055
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#39373f is the less saturated color, while #260075 is the most saturated one.
